Oracle PL/SQL Developer

Location: Hybrid in Charlotte, NC (3 days onsite, 2 days remote)

The Oracle Developer is responsible for designing, developing, enhancing, and supporting Oracle database applications, PL/SQL programs, and reporting solutions. This role requires technical expertise and communication skills to collaborate effectively with business users, project managers, architects, QA teams, and production support teams.

Key Responsibilities
  • Design, develop, test, and maintain Oracle database objects, including PL/SQL packages, procedures, functions, triggers, tables, views, indexes, and materialized views.
  • Analyze business requirements and translate them into technical solutions.
  • Perform performance tuning, query optimization, and root-cause analysis to resolve production issues.
  • Create technical design documents, data flow diagrams, and deployment plans.
  • Support application releases, code promotions, and change management activities.
  • Ensure compliance with security, audit, and data governance standards.
  • Act as a liaison between technical teams and business stakeholders, facilitating requirement-gathering sessions and design reviews.
  • Provide status updates, risks, and dependencies to management.
Technical Skills
  • Proficiency with Oracle Database (12c/19c or later).
  • Advanced PL/SQL development experience.
  • Knowledge of SQL performance tuning.
  • Understanding of data modeling and database design.
  • Familiarity with version control tools such as Git or Bitbucket.
  • Experience supporting large-scale enterprise applications.
Communication Skills
  • Verbal and written communication abilities.
  • Presentation and stakeholder-management skills.
  • Ability to gather and clarify complex requirements and lead technical discussions.
  • Experience communicating with management and business users.
  • Documentation and analytical skills.
